Home Care Worker

Employment Type

Casual

Location

Whyalla

About the Role

Based in Whyalla, you will deliver high‐quality personal care to Helping Hand clients living in their own homes. Each day is unique and may include breaks in shifts depending on client requirements. While you will mostly be working independently, you'll be supported by a team of coordinators, administrators and other staff.

Responsibilities

* Support clients to live in their homes by helping with household chores.
* Stay aware of changes to a client's health and emotional wellbeing, and advise a Helping Hand Coordinator.
* Maintain a friendly, professional and positive manner when representing Helping Hand in the community.
* Deliver social support by engaging meaningfully with clients in each interaction.

Qualifications

* Current First Aid and CPR Certificate (or willingness to obtain one).
* Certificate III in Individual Support or Aged Care.
* Current Australian driver licence (P2 minimum).
* A registered, well‐maintained, reliable and insured vehicle.
* Good communication skills, including speaking and writing clearly and accurately.
* Ability to operate smartphones and apps (e.g., Microsoft Outlook).
* A valid NDIS Worker Screening clearance (or willingness to obtain one).

Desirable

* Previous experience in personal care delivery in a community setting.
* Demonstrated ability to make decisions, take initiative and work independently.

Benefits

* Part of a warm, friendly team that genuinely cares about you and your wellbeing.
* Salary packaging up to $15,899 per year.
* Additional $2,650 tax‐free per year with Meal and Entertainment Card.
* Discounted private health insurance and Employee Assistance Program.
* Fitness Passport Program and discounted gym memberships for you and your family.

Helping Hand welcomes and respects the diversity of our clients, staff and volunteers. All applicants must have the right to work in Australia and hold relevant checks or be willing to obtain them. Successful candidates will be required to attend induction sessions before commencing work. Working in a high‐risk setting, we strongly recommend COVID‐19 and flu vaccinations.
